Gaehwa (개화)

Gaehwa (개화)

8.1Km    2021-03-26

52-5, Namdaemun-ro, Jung-gu, Seoul
+82-2-776-0508

Located a short walking distance away from Myeong-dong's Chinese Embassy, Gaehwa boasts 50 years of tradition as the 3rd Chinese restaurant chain in Korea. Gaehwa's jajangmyeon (noodles in black bean sauce) and palbochae (stir-fried seafood and vegetables) are extremely popular. This is a great place for a quick meal, as it serves plenty of food at affordable prices. Gaehwa has been using the same traditional cooking style and unchanging service values to create a comfortable atmosphere like visiting home.

Museo de Arte de Seúl, sede central en Seosomun [SeMA] (서울시립미술관(서소문본관))

8.2Km    2025-05-13

Deoksugung-gil 61, Jung-gu, Seúl

El museo que une el palacio Deoksugung con el palacio Gyeonghuigung fue construido en la parte restante de la antigua Corte Suprema en el estilo de los años 1920. Los 6 espacios de exposición más importantes son el vestíbulo principal, la sala de esculturas y la sala especial que expone colecciones de arte moderno de Corea. En el vestíbulo Chon Kyung-Ja, situado en el segundo piso, los visitantes podrán contemplar 93 pinturas procedentes de donaciones. Principalmente retratos o pinturas de naturaleza muerta creadas de 1940 a 1990 por el artista Chon Kyung-Ja, considerada como la principal pintora femenina coreana. La sala de arte experimental puede acoger alrededor de 200 visitantes y tiene una multifuncionalidad ya se trate de proyecciones cinematográficas, música, conciertos, teatro, etc. El museo tiene una tienda de arte y una cafetería. Samseong Bbalgan Yangnyeom Sutbulgui (삼성 빨간양념 숯불구이)

Samseong Bbalgan Yangnyeom Sutbulgui (삼성 빨간양념 숯불구이)

8.2Km    2020-06-16

37, Namdaemun-ro 1-gil, Jung-gu, Seoul
+82-2-752-6449

Samseong Bbalgan Yangnyeomg has been famous for its charcoal-grilled dishes since 1972, and is especially well known for its spicy seasoning made from powdered red pepper, garlic, and ginger. Pork is mixed with the seasoning, giving it the characteristic red color and unique flavor, and then grilled over hot coals. This is the perfect restaurant for spicy food-lovers or those looking for a challenge.
Other dishes include jumulleok (marinated pork) and donggeurangttaeng (batter-fried meatballs). Jumulleok is made by seasoning fresh meat, whereas donggeurangttaeng is made by cutting the frozen meat into small pieces, and then marinating it. Older adults usually prefer jumulleok, while the young prefer donggeurangttaeng.
